Material
100% natural sisal from agave sisalana fiber, woven into a refined linen-weave flatweave texture.
Standard Width
4m broadloom rolls, with custom-cut bound rugs and runners available by project request.
Commercial Specs
ASTM E648 Class I fire-retardant option, Class 32 commercial traffic, natural latex and jute backing, permanent antistatic behavior.

Specification Guidance
When to Choose Natural Sisal
Natural sisal is best for dry commercial interiors where texture, sustainability, and a premium natural look matter. It is especially effective in office receptions, retail showrooms, galleries, hospitality public zones, and design-led workspace projects.
For spaces with frequent spills or moisture, VISHOME can also discuss synthetic sisal-look alternatives that keep the woven aesthetic while improving cleanability.

Is sisal carpet waterproof?
Natural sisal is not waterproof and should not be saturated with water. For high-moisture or stain-sensitive environments, a synthetic sisal-look option may be more practical.
